WebWithdrawals when you're younger trigger an added 10 percent penalty. This applies to rollover accounts like any other traditional IRA. Reporting If you take out more than $10 from your IRA this year, your broker sends you a 1099-R before the end of next January. This shows you how much you withdrew and if any of the money was tax-free. WebSep 20, 2024 · For Fidelity, 401 rollover checks going into an IRA need to be made out to Fidelity Management Trust Company , FBO . FBO indicates who the checks is for the benefit of which is you! If you are rolling over into a new 401 at Fidelity, the check should be made out to Fidelity Investments Institutional Operations Company, Inc. , FBO .
